WebMar 17, 2024 · The balloon is coated on its outer surface with paclitaxel, which is then transferred to the urethral wall and is theorised to prevent the stricture from recurring. The Optilume® Drug Coated Balloon has emerged as a novel, minimally-invasive solution to patients with recurrent urethral stricture. It is routinely performed as an outpatient, local anaesthetic procedure.
